Create wildlife habitats and attract birds, bees, and other creatures to your very own garden: ‘;A must-have for any gardening library.’ Gardeners World Filled with beautiful photos, this book is a practical guide for anyone who wants to make a home for wildlife in their gardeneven if they don’t have a lot of space. Divided into sections on shelter, food, and water, it includes: *advice on the best nectar and pollen plants to grow *dos and don’ts of bird feeding *information on organic methods of pest control *ten projectswith step-by-step picturesthat will help encourage wildlife, such as creating a bumblebee nester, making a green roof, and building a hedgehog box Also included is a mini field guide, which will help you identify the birds and other creatures you’re likely to spot in your garden. The Wildlife Gardener gives tips on particular species, explaining what to look out for and how to cater for specific birds, mammals, bees, butterflies, moths, and pond life. ‘;A joyous book.’ Alan Titchmarsh, author of My Secret Garden
